GLUTEN-FREE VEGAN BAKING TIPS

  1. Use extra vanilla when baking. It will help balance out those nutty flavours that appear in gluten-free baking. 
  2. The smaller the better. I always recommend making cakes no larger than 6 to 7 inches or smaller. I find that the smaller the cake, the better the bake. 
  3. Don’t be afraid to under-bake your cake slightly. You want to retain extra moisture in your cake as GF cakes can be a little dry. I usually bake it for 5 minutes less and test it with a skewer. If the skewer still has a few crumbs and a tiny bit of moisture on it, it’s ready to come out of the oven. 
  4. Use 25 percent more raising agents (baking soda or baking powder) if you’re converting a recipe to gluten free.
  5. Do worry about over-mixing your batter even though there is no gluten to overdevelop. It still affects the outcome of your cake. Just mix until just combined.
  6. If you’re finding your GF cake is coming out dry, try using a vegetable shortening as your main fat source, this can add extra moisture.
  7. If you’re converting a recipe to gluten free, experiment with adjusting the temperature of your oven 10C/50F lower.

Ingredients

Units Scale

DRY

  • 1 1/2 cup white rice flour
  • 3/4 cup almond meal ((almond flour is even better))
  • 1/2 cup potato starch
  • 3/4 cup white sugar
  • 3 tsp baking powder
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1 tsp salt

WET

  • 1 1/2 cup soy milk
  • 1 1/2 tbsp white vinegar
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 tbsp pure vanilla or 1 tsp vanilla bean paste

EGG REPLACER

  • 3 tbsp ground flaxseed meal
  • 7 1/2 tbsp hot water

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 160C/320F.
  2. Grease and line three 6-inch cake tins with vegetable oil and baking paper and then dust with a tiny amount of gluten-free flour to coat the cake tin.
  3. Make your flaxseed egg by mixing flaxseed and water together and set aside to thicken.
  4. In a large mixing bowl sieve flours, starch,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ar together and give it a quick whisk to combine ingredients.
  5. In a large jug, mix vinegar with soy milk until it becomes thick. Then add oil and vanilla and mix together. Add thickened flax egg and stir.
  6. Pour liquid into flour bowl and gently fold ingredients together with a whisk until just combined.
  7. Pour batter into each cake tin making sure they both have the same amount of batter and tap on the bench to release air bubbles.
  8. Place tins into the middle of your oven and bake for 25 minutes or until a skewer poked into the middle comes out almost clean.
  9. Allow to sit in the cake tin for 10 minutes before turning onto a cooling rack. Run a knife around the outside of the cake before flipping it onto your cooling rack.
  10. Let it completely cool down and ice with your favourite vegan buttercream.

Vegan shortbread is such an easy cookie recipe to bake. The gluten free version is just as stress-free and the flavours are virtually the same. The only slight difference is the cookie texture. It’s a little more ‘crispy’. I think this is due to the almond meal but hardly noticeable. This cookie is very fragrant in flavour and pairs well with rose herbal teas.

Gluten Free Vegan Rosewater Thyme Shortbread

The four flavours in this recipe are Rosewater paired with Thyme for the cookie base. Lemon for the simple lemon buttercream icing. And pistachio which is crushed and sprinkled on top. These flavours all compliment each other to create a really lovely eating experience.

Gluten Free Vegan Rosewater Thyme Shortbread

The flours used for the recipe are white rice flour, cornflour or cornstarch and almond meal. You shouldn’t have any issues getting these at your local supermarket as they are very common.

Gluten Free Vegan Rosewater Thyme Shortbread

Here are a few tips when making this recipe:
1. Keep your butter and your hands cold and make sure you chill your dough. Don’t skip this step. It helps with the cutting out process and helps the cookies keep their shape.
2. The perfect thickness is 0.5 centimetres or 5 millimetres.
3. Know how strong your rosewater is. I find some brands are really strong and others are weak. You want to be able to taste the rosewater slightly at the end of eating the cookie.

Gluten Free Vegan Rosewater Thyme Shortbread

Using a really high-quality lemon essence will help your buttercream sing and balance out the sweetness of the cookie.

Ingredients

Units Scale

Shortbread Cookie

  • 200 g white rice flour (plus extra)
  • 100 g cornstarch or cornflour
  • 50 g almond meal
  • 250 g vegan butter or margarine (cold and cubed)
  • 2 tbs rose water ((more if your rosewater is weak, less if its super strong))
  • 1 tsp vanilla bean paste
  • 80 g icing or powdered sugar
  • 2.5 tbs lightly chopped fresh thyme leaves

Lemon Buttercream

  • 100 g vegan butter or margarine
  • 100 g icing sugar
  • 1 tbs lemon juice
  • 1/2 tsp high quality lemon essence
  • 1/2 tsp high quality vanilla bean paste
  • vegan pink food colouring
  • 1/2 cup crushed pistachios

Instructions

To Make Cookies

  1. Sieve all flours and sugar together in a large mixing bowl. Add Thyme and mix through.
  2. Add cubed cold butter, rosewater and vanilla. Using your hands or a pastry cutter rub butter into flour until it becomes a soft dough ball. If it’s too wet you can add more rice flour (not cornflour). If it’s too dry add a tbs of water.
    ANOTHER OPTION – you can add all ingredients into a mix master with a paddle attachment and mix it together and create a ball
  3. Cover and chill in the fridge for around 30 mins or until dough starts to become stiff. Pre-heat your oven to 155C / 311F. Line 2 large baking trays with baking paper.
  4. Roll dough out on a bench floured with rice flour to 5mm or 1/2 cm thick and cut with cookie cutter. I used a 6cm sized cutter. If the dough is still too mushy, chill it in the fridge for another 20 mins.
  5. Place cookies on the tray and bake for 25-27 minutes on the top rack of your oven. Check them at the 22 min mark. They will remain pale but go slightly brown on the bottom and around the edges. The tops should be firm. Remove from oven and allow to completely cool before icing.

To Make Lemon Buttercream

  1. Using a hand mixer beat butter, icing sugar, lemon juice, lemon essence and vanilla together in a small mixing bowl, until completely smooth and creamy.
  2. Ice a small amount on top of each cookie and sprinkle with crushed pistachios and any leftover Thyme leaves.

Ingredients

INGREDIENTS
Egg replacer
1 tbsp ground flaxseed
2 1/2 tbsp boiling water

Dry Ingredients
3/4 cup buckwheat flour
1/4 cup almond meal
1/4 cup brown rice flour
1/4 cup cornflour or cornstarch
1/2 cup white sugar
2 tsp baking powder
1/2 tsp baking soda
1/4 tsp salt
1 tsp cinnamon
1/2 tsp ground ginger
1/2 tsp ground cloves

Wet Ingredients
1 1/3 cup soy milk
1 tbsp vinegar
1/4 cup veggie oil you can use melted coconut oil also
2 tsp vanilla extract

Topping
1 large apple
1/2 cup crushed walnuts
1/2 cup icing sugar
1 tbsp hot water
1 tbsp golden syrup


Instructions

HOW TO MAKE THE CAKE

  1. Preheat your conventional oven to 175C/347F. Grease your 6 inch round cake tin with vegetable oil, then line with baking paper and lightly grease with more vegetable oil. Then dust with a small amount of cornflour or starch. Tap upside down to release any excess flour.
  2. Firstly make your egg replacer, mix the flaxseed with the boiling water and stir. Set aside.
  3. In a large mixing bowl, sieve all your dry ingredients together and mix together with a whisk.
  4. In a large jug, mix your soy milk and vinegar together until it thickens. Add remaining wet ingredients, including your flaxseed egg, and mix together really well.
  5. Thinly slice your apple and place in a small bowl. Cover apple pieces with a tiny amount of your wet ingredients and then cover with a small amount of the dry ingredients. Put aside 2 tbsp of the flour mix.
  6. Make a well in the centre of your flour mix and pour in your milk mix. Gently mix together using a whisk until just combined. Pour into your cake tin and gently tap on the bench to release air bubbles.
  7. Sprinkle the spare flour mix over the top of the batter. Sprinkle 3⁄4 of the walnuts over the flour. Arrange the apple onto the cake starting from the outside and working your way to the middle.
  8. Bake on the middle rack in the oven for 45-50 mins or until a skewer comes out almost clean. Remove from oven and allow to sit in the cake tin for 10 mins before turning onto a cooling rack.

HOW TO MAKE GLAZE

  1. To make your glaze mix together your icing sugar, water and golden syrup until combined and pour over the top of your cake. Decorate with walnuts. Best served with icecream.

 

Notes

Store this cake in an airtight container NOT in the fridge as it will dry out.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 50 grams pitted dates soaked overnight
  • 1/2 ltr coconut milk
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t
  • 400 grams white sugar
  • 120 ml water
  • 1 tsp white vinegar
  • 3 tbs corn flour (or corn starch if US) (mixed with 3 tbs water)

Instructions

  1. Blend coconut milk, cinnamon, dates, salt and vanilla until smooth and creamy. Set aside.
  2. In a medium saucepan, combine sugar, water, white vinegar in saucepan.
  3. On a high heat bring to the boil without stirring. Watch the pot the whole time because it can suddenly go brown and burn.
  4. Once the sugar suddenly turns golden, take off the heat and allow to sit for a minute until the bubbles die down.
  5. Very slowly stir in coconut milk mix (it’s going to bubble so be EXTRA careful) and then return back to your stove top on a medium high heat.
  6. Stir in the corn starch/corn flour paste until completely combined and bring to a boil whilst viciously stirring – don’t let it burn or stick to the bottom. Take off heat once it starts to thicken.
  7. Let cool and then strain if you want to make sure your sauce is 100% smooth.
  8. See recipe notes for variations and watch the video demo for more tips.

Notes

LIGHTER CREAMY VERSION: You can add additional coconut milk if you want a lighter version that isn’t so sweet
SALTED CARAMEL VERSION: Start by adding 1/4 tsp more sea salt until you’re happy with the ‘saltness’ of the sauce
SPICPY CARAMEL VERSION: Add more spices like nutmeg and a chai spice mix
